Paris Jackson Disavows Estate-Backed Michael Biopic, Rebuts Colman Domingo’s Claim of Her Support

She says producers ignored her early script notes, calling the portrayal “sugar‑coated,” inaccurate.

Overview

  • In Instagram posts this week, Paris Jackson said she had zero percent involvement in Michael and asked to be left out of the project’s promotion.
  • She said she read an early draft, flagged dishonesty, was told her notes would not be addressed, and described Hollywood biopics as controlled narratives with inaccuracies and lies.
  • Her comments counter Colman Domingo’s remarks to People at a Venice amfAR event claiming Paris and her brother Prince were very supportive and that he had chatted with her about the film.
  • The Lionsgate release, directed by Antoine Fuqua and starring Jaafar Jackson as Michael, is produced with the Jackson estate and is scheduled for April 24, 2026.
  • Earlier reporting noted rewrites and reshoots tied to legal constraints, which production sources disputed, and family responses have differed, with Prince previously expressing support.
